Prada's Spring/Summer 2027 men's collection, designed by Miuccia Prada and Raf Simons, debuted at Milan Fashion Week with a focus on minimalist, jeans-inspired basics. The collection marks a return to distilled, unadorned aesthetics for the luxury brand.

Why it matters

Prada's design direction often sets broader trends in the luxury fashion industry, signaling a potential shift away from maximalism toward functional simplicity.
